Log Out Of Luggage: Tips To Travel With Style
If you are traveling a great deal, there's always a catch of what you will bring and in how you actually will bring them. There is also a matter of what luggage will suit you the most. But to travel with style and ease, you need to remember some things. These many not necessarily mean an absolute way of travelling but just simple reminders will do.
1. Do not use any lock. Unless you are carrying the treasures of Egypt inside your bag, you have no reason to lock your bag. Otherwise if you carry valuable documents and items, have them in your hand-carry where you can keep an eye of them inside the plane cabin. But if what you're carrying is nothing but ordinary items you should not lock your bags because they will certainly and painfully impede your travel. If for some precautionary measures the airline would like to check all baggage, it would be easier for you to open yours and will save both you and the flight more time.
2. What's with the tags? You should not put all dangling tags or items on your luggage as decoration or whatever. The only tags that should be on your bag are those airline tags that they give you during check-in, otherwise do not put so many tags on them. This will prevent your bags from getting stuck to something later on. The more tags you have on your bag, the more chances you have of risking getting stuck. So be a little bit clean and tidy of your bags not only for yourself but for other passengers and the airline too.
3. Proper storage. If for some instance you are waiting for your flight, do not carry your luggage out with you wherever you go especially if you cannot sit tight in one place and wait for the right time. Unless you don't find it a nuisance carrying them off around, there is every reason for you to properly store them perhaps at hotel front desks but of course this will cost you something.
4. Proper handling. One great advantage of travelling is the opportunity of having to buy souvenirs home. But in order to do this you need to know proper handling of the luggage you have. Never assume that the airline will properly take good care of you luggage unless you give them every reason to. So tell the airline staff from the very beginning that your luggage is delicate and they will do the rest for you.
5. Keep an eye on your bags. This is I think the most important tip in travelling. You need to watch them more closely and to make sure they are complete. Most missing luggage is on ground than on air. Be familiar with all your things.
